A new commercial building valued at more than $5.4 million is coming to 1000 Marais Trail in Greenville County after a construction permit was issued on August 19. The project, filed under Cone Mills Acquisition Group L, marks fresh development activity on a site linked to the historic Cone Mills textile brand.

What the Permits Show

Permit 26-005985, classified as commercial new construction, carries a valuation of $5,421,112. The permit was issued to Cone Mills Acquisition Group L as the property owner, with KNR Electrical Services Inc. listed as the contractor of record. The address at 1000 Marais Trail falls within unincorporated Greenville County, and no additional description or comments accompany the filing.

The permit type — commercial new construction — indicates a ground-up build rather than a renovation or tenant upfit. While the filing does not specify the intended use of the building, the dollar figure and commercial classification point to a project of considerable scale. KNR Electrical Services Inc., an electrical contractor, is the only trade contractor named on the permit so far, suggesting additional subcontractor permits may follow as the project progresses.
